There are a variety of options in geographic information systems (GIS) software with pros and cons associated with all of them. Why explore geospatial data analysis with Python programming? Python has been embraced by the geospatial community and can be found integrated with a wide variety of commercial products such as ESRI, backend for other software packages such as QGIS and Geographic Resources Analysis Support System (GRASS), and Google Earth. Author Bonny P. McClain demonstrates why detecting and quantifying patterns in geospatial data is vital. Both proprietary and open source platforms allow you to process and visualize spatial information. This book is for people familiar with data analysis or visualization who are eager to explore geospatial integration with Python.

Service meshes such as Istio provide a lot of value to teams running microservices architectures or cloud workloads. But they do have their drawbacks. To help you implement their capabilities, most service meshes use a sidecar proxy, an architecture that comes with operational complexities and costly resource overhead. In this report, authors Lin Sun and Christian Posta from Solo.io dive into Istio ambient mesh, a new sidecarless data plane mode designed for transparent application onboarding, simplified operation, and reduced infrastructure cost. Developers, architects, and platform owners will examine the challenges of existing sidecar architecture, explore the benefits of ambient mesh, and learn how to get started with Istio ambient service mesh.

Create rich and dynamic web applications on the Azure cloud platform using static web development techniques built around Blazor WebAssembly, APIs, and Markup, while leveraging the paradigm commonly known as JAMstack. This book starts off showing you how to create an environment for deploying your first application. You will create an Azure Static Web App using a Blazor WebAssembly application and adding dynamic content using an Azure function before deploying from GitHub. You will learn to debug your Static Web App locally, both inside of Visual Studio and from the command line using a simple Static Web App CLI command. The book takes a deep dive into the CLI to allow you to emulate all of the features available in the Azure environment. You will learn the authentication and authorizing options with your app and create new blog posts with the post creation function. Included in the book is setting a custom domain and discussion of the options. The book also explores the differences between the free and standard hosting tiers for Static Web Apps.
